Transaction 608637b0d13981ac15aee8f0eb12f6c1c50951c172aef6e551d2051b8d555d09
1 Input
1 Output
-
608637b0d13981ac15aee8f0eb12f6c1c50951c172aef6e551d2051b8d555d09:0
- value
- 256320
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b556f00b6f004b2e866e794e37d4d53acfb50801 OP_EQUAL
- address
- 3JDrNoPQFnAaXVct2oeQUZRF6KAMvXpT8G